From 708dd9eadab07345778314db57ab98cbdc77998d Mon Sep 17 00:00:00 2001
From: admin <weikou2014>
Date: 星期四, 30 四月 2020 11:55:37 +0800
Subject: [PATCH] 爬单重复消息bug修改,商品详情过滤大淘客推荐语

---
 fanli/src/main/java/com/yeshi/fanli/service/impl/user/vip/UserVIPPreInfoServiceImpl.java |   19 ++++++++++++-------
 1 files changed, 12 insertions(+), 7 deletions(-)

diff --git a/fanli/src/main/java/com/yeshi/fanli/service/impl/user/vip/UserVIPPreInfoServiceImpl.java b/fanli/src/main/java/com/yeshi/fanli/service/impl/user/vip/UserVIPPreInfoServiceImpl.java
index b6bd027..93c893d 100644
--- a/fanli/src/main/java/com/yeshi/fanli/service/impl/user/vip/UserVIPPreInfoServiceImpl.java
+++ b/fanli/src/main/java/com/yeshi/fanli/service/impl/user/vip/UserVIPPreInfoServiceImpl.java
@@ -93,6 +93,10 @@
 	public void addUserVIPPreInfo(UserVIPPreInfo info) throws UserVIPPreInfoException {
 		if (info == null || info.getUid() == null || info.getProcess() == null)
 			throw new UserVIPPreInfoException(1, "淇℃伅涓嶅畬鏁�");
+		for (Long fuid : Constant.NO_UPGRADE_UIDS) {// 绂佹涓嶈兘鍗囩骇鐨勭敤鎴峰崌绾�
+			if (info.getUid().longValue() == fuid)
+				return;
+		}
 
 		UserVIPPreInfo oldInfo = userVIPPreInfoMapper.selectByUidAndProcess(info.getUid(), info.getProcess());
 		if (oldInfo != null)
@@ -177,14 +181,13 @@
 			}
 		}
 	}
-	
+
 	@Override
 	@RequestSerializableByKeyService(key = "#uid")
 	@Transactional(rollbackFor = Exception.class)
 	public void upgradeVipByTeamNum(Long uid) {
 		vipTeamVerify(uid);
 	}
-	
 
 	@Override
 	@RequestSerializableByKeyService(key = "#tid")
@@ -197,8 +200,6 @@
 		vipTeamVerify(boss.getId());
 	}
 
-	
-	
 	/**
 	 * 楠岃瘉鐢ㄦ埛鏄惁婊¤冻鍗囩骇闃熷憳鏉′欢
 	 * @param uid
@@ -220,11 +221,17 @@
 
 		long limitFirst7 = 0;
 		String first7 = userVipConfigService.getValueByKey("vip_pre_7_first_level_team_count");
+		if (Constant.IS_TEST)
+			first7 = "30";
+
 		if (!StringUtil.isNullOrEmpty(first7)) {
 			limitFirst7 = Long.parseLong(first7);
 		}
+
 		long limitSecond7 = 0;
 		String second7 = userVipConfigService.getValueByKey("vip_pre_7_second_level_team_count");
+		if (Constant.IS_TEST)
+			second7 = "30";
 		if (!StringUtil.isNullOrEmpty(second7)) {
 			limitSecond7 = Long.parseLong(second7);
 		}
@@ -238,9 +245,7 @@
 			}
 		}
 	}
-	
-	
-	
+
 	/**
 	 * 浜岄樁娈�
 	 * 

--
Gitblit v1.8.0